Description We are seeking a proficient ERP Administrator to join our dynamic team. The ERP Administrator will be responsible for managing and maintaining our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) system to ensure its smooth operation. This role involves implementing system updates, providing technical support, and collaborating with various departments to optimize system functionality. The ideal candidate will possess strong analytical skills, excellent problem-solving abilities, and a deep understanding of ERP systems.Technical Support:

Provide 1st and 2nd level technical support for the ERP system and related applications.

Troubleshoot ERP-related issues to ensure optimal performance.

Manage ERP-related application security and user access.

ERP System Maintenance:

Plan, test, and deploy ERP releases, upgrades, and patches.

Coordinate with ERP vendor, ERP user group, and other support resources for issue resolution and to keep up to date with trends and new features related to the ERP system.

Track and manage all ERP-related support requests in a helpdesk system and ensure prompt response and resolution.

Business Analysis:

Design, develop, and implement information systems in support of the global company.

Document workflows and procedures for process improvement.

Generate reports via Crystal Reports, SSRS, or similar tools.

Perform ERP-related customizations including screen design changes and the implementation of business rules within the ERP system with the help of ERP-related development tools.

Draft user guides and perform functional validation for pre-release systems.
